Mom arrested, charged with battery, neglect after baby is found dead

Baby suffered a skull fracture and hemorrhaging

Updated: Friday, 10 Dec 2010, 11:54 AM EST
Published : Friday, 10 Dec 2010, 11:52 AM EST

FORT WAYNE, Ind. (WANE) - A Fort Wayne woman was arrested Thursday on battery and neglect charges after her 4-week-old baby was found dead.

According to the Fort Wayne Police Department, around 8:30 a.m. Thursday, officers were called to the 5700 block of Fairfield Avenue where LaDawn Depree Johnson,25, arrived with her deceased infant.

One-month-old Alyssa Johnson was pronounced dead at the scene by medical personnel.

After conducting an autopsy on the baby Thursday, the Allen County Coroner reported the child died as a result of a skull fracture with subdural and subarachnoid hemorrhage, or bleeding around the brain.

Police said a home in the 7900 block of Serenity Drive is also possibly related to the investigation.

LaDawn Johnson has been charged with Battery, a Class A felony and two felony counts of Neglect of a Dependent, Class A and Class C.

Alyssa's death is Fort Wayne and Allen County's 26th homicide for 2010.
